Quail Hollow Neighborhood Overview

Overview

Quail Hollow is a well-established, residential neighborhood located in the Naples Manor area of Naples, Florida. Situated east of I-75 and just south of Immokalee Road, it offers a convenient location that balances suburban tranquility with relatively easy access to the beaches, downtown Naples, and major commercial corridors. The neighborhood is characterized by its quiet, tree-lined streets, a mix of mature landscaping, and a strong sense of community, appealing to those seeking a more affordable entry point into the Naples lifestyle compared to pricier coastal communities.

Developed primarily in the 1980s and 1990s, Quail Hollow reflects the architectural styles popular during that era, with a focus on single-family homes on spacious lots. The area is part of unincorporated Collier County, which provides a more relaxed atmosphere while still being just minutes from the city's renowned amenities. Its location in Naples Manor places it close to essential services and major employers, making it a practical choice for both families and professionals.

Housing & Real Estate

The housing stock in Quail Hollow consists almost exclusively of single-family homes, ranging from classic Florida ranch-style houses to larger two-story residences. Lot sizes are generally generous, often a quarter-acre or more, providing ample space for pools, screened lanais, and lush tropical landscaping—a hallmark of Florida living. Architectural styles include concrete block construction with stucco finishes, tile roofs, and designs that emphasize indoor-outdoor living.

As a more value-oriented neighborhood within the Naples market, Quail Hollow offers a compelling alternative, with median home prices typically below the county-wide median. The market is predominantly owner-occupied, contributing to a stable community feel. Recent trends have seen steady appreciation, driven by Naples' overall desirability and the neighborhood's attractive lot sizes, with many homes being updated or remodeled to meet modern expectations.

Parks & Recreation

Residents of Quail Hollow enjoy access to several nearby parks and recreational facilities. The highlight is the expansive Eagle Lakes Community Park, located just to the north, which features multiple sports fields, tennis and pickleball courts, a dog park, a fishing pier on a stocked lake, and a scenic walking trail. This park serves as a major community hub for outdoor activities and organized sports leagues.

For golf enthusiasts, the area is surrounded by numerous public and private golf courses, a defining feature of the Naples region. While Quail Hollow itself is not a golf course community, several premier courses are just minutes away. The neighborhood's proximity to the western edge of the Everglades also provides unique opportunities for nature exploration, airboat tours, and wildlife viewing, offering a distinct Florida experience beyond the beach.
